something like http://www.expedia.com.sg I think their program already has the template but I dont know how to make it work.
Why don't you call up expedia and ask them? Im sure they will give it to you for a few million dollars.
you know, sometimes the websites don't approve their names on affiliate websites.. e.g. if you run expedia affiliate website, you can be removed from their aff program because of their name in your domain. better write them!